Universal variable life insurance is a type of permanent life insurance that combines a death benefit with a savings component. The policyholder can invest a portion of their premium payments into a separate account, known as the cash value account. This account earns interest and grows over time, allowing the policyholder to accumulate wealth and borrow against the cash value if needed. The death benefit can be adjusted or modified to suit the policyholder's changing needs.

Policyholders can typically invest their cash value account in a variety of assets, such as stocks, bonds, or mutual funds. The investment options available will depend on the specific policy and insurance company.
The US life insurance market is experiencing a shift towards more flexible and customizable products. Universal variable life insurance is no exception, offering policyholders the ability to adjust their coverage and investment options as their financial needs change. This flexibility, combined with the potential for tax-deferred growth and cash value accumulation, has made universal variable life insurance an attractive option for many Americans.
